The case report of Mycobacterium arupense wound infection in diabetes mellitus patients; the first report and literature review

Mycobacterium arupense is among the opportunist pathogens of atypical mycobacteria emergence (atypical mycobacteria) that is one of the isolated and reported environmental and clinical specimens.
